Pediatric Orbital Cellulitis Complicated by Cavernous Sinus Thrombosis: A Pediatric Simulation Case for Residents

Introduction:
Orbital cellulitis is primarily a pediatric disease; although distinct from periorbital cellulitis, presenting symptoms may overlap, creating a challenge in diagnosis. If untreated, it can result in severe complications such as vision impairment, intracranial infection, cavernous sinus thrombosis (CST), and death. We created a simulation course to teach pediatric residents to recognize and treat this important diagnosis and its life-threatening complications.
Methods:
This simulation features a 10-year-old patient who presents with eye pain and swelling due to orbital cellulitis. Learning objectives include recognizing and managing orbital cellulitis, identifying sequelae of orbital cellulitis (eg, CST), and liaising with surgical and intensive care consultants. Facilitators led a postsimulation debrief and didactic session, and participants completed an anonymous postcourse evaluation. The entire session took 60 minutes.
Results:
This simulation was performed 4 different times, involving a total of 27 participants, all of whom were pediatric residents. Twenty-three participants completed the postcourse survey. The average overall course was rated 5.7/6, and participants reported that the knowledge gained from the session will be helpful to them in their practice and will help improve patient outcomes (mean = 3.9/4).
Discussion:
Our simulation was well received by participants and provided them with an opportunity to learn how to manage a highly morbid complication of orbital cellulitis, a common pediatric condition. This educational session can be completed in an hour and requires no advanced preparation for participants. This simulation can be adapted to run in a low-fidelity environment across a range of medical subspecialty training programs.
